How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Bealeton?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Bealeton Studio Apartments | $2,718 | $1,514 | $6,919 |
Bealeton 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,217 | $637 | $7,444 |
Bealeton 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,468 | $1,206 | $8,231 |
Bealeton 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,369 | $1,349 | $4,401 |
Bealeton 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,489 | $1,489 | $1,489 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Bealeton
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Bealeton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Bealeton ranges from $637 to $7,444 with an average monthly rent of $2,217.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Bealeton c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Bealeton range from $1,206 to $8,231.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,468.
How expensive are Bealeton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 15 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Bealeton on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,349 to $4,401 - averaging $2,369 for the location.
